Jessica Jones is one of Marvels more powerful superheroes, but the origins of her powers differ slightly between the comics and the Netflix show. Jessica boasts super human strength and durability.

While Jessica hasn’t properly documented her top strength level, yet, she has demonstrated that she possesses enough brute force to lift a two-ton police car without noticeable effort and toss it to officers away from approaching them during their operation.
